TICKET-4471: rotatectl skips expired entries

Severity: high. Component: rotatectl (Kestrelbay internal).

Repro:
1. Seed vault with two secrets, one past TTL.
2. Run rotatectl sweep --env staging.
3. Expired entry remains; no error logged.

Expected: expired secrets rotated first. Actual: silently skipped.

To reproduce against staging you need the sweep-scope credential. Use the token below when calling the staging rotation endpoint.

login token, bagug-kafop: eyJhbGciOiJIUzI1NiIsInR5cCI6IkpXVCJ9.eyJzdWIiOiIcMLov2In0.Z5RLDIfp

## ProfileVault Environments

ProfileVault shards the user-profile store across four partitions in staging and sixteen in production. Shard assignment is hash-based on account ID, so rebalancing only happens during planned resharding windows. If you're on call and see hot-shard alerts, check the partition map before touching anything — most pages resolve to a single overloaded shard. The active shard configuration for production is as follows.

settings of hahag-taweg:
[jorius]
team = gilox
access_code = ac_b64218
host = jorius.zarqelstack.example
port = 8080
owner = quenath.briax
peer = eliix.halixcloud.corp

MEMO — Kettling Depot Receiving

Uniform sets for the new Kettling depot arrive Wednesday via Ashgrove courier: 40 boxes, sorted by size, manifest attached to box one. Check the count at the dock before signing; shortages go straight to stores, not the courier. The hand-over instruction the courier will follow is set out below.

drop instructions, tafof-baguf: the holmir gilox courier leaves the sormir ulaok holdor ledger at gate 5596 under passcode 257343

Minutes — Management Meeting, Insurance Renewal

Present: T. Orvelle (chair), M. Quaine, S. Debbington.

Our broker, Lanthorn & Pace, flagged a likely 18% premium rise on the group policy. We agreed to get a second quote and trim cover on the mothballed Grelby site. Renewal decision deferred to next month. For board context, the confidential note on business plans follows below.

management briefing: Gross margin on Ralael came in at 15 percent against a plan of 10 percent. Only 9 of the 100 pilot accounts renewed Ralael, so a churn review is set for April 1.